7-10 years experienced in Core Java , Spring Batch/Boot and data structures
• Solid working experience of Java, OOP, modular code development, design pattern.
• Server back end and API/Service development experience is required
• Experience with JUnit/TestNG, Maven, Oracle, UNIX
• Experience using Bitbucket/GIT Stash as the SCM
• Strong problem solving and analytical skills, proactive and go-getter
• Good grasp of industry best practices in enterprise-class software development, agile methodology
• Experience with Application Performance Monitoring and code profiling • Expert knowledge in Java / JEE and coding best practices.
• Expert knowledge in Spring, ORM, JMS, Web services and other distributed technologies.
• Ability to design frameworks which are extensible and flexible.
• Has experience in CI and Dev Ops Understands Jenkins, GitHub, etc.
• Looking for someone who can bring himself/herself up to speed quickly in our current environment.
• Good communication skills. Able to articulate clearly his/her ideas
• Experience in Spring Integration, Caching, or any similar technology is a plus Mandatory Certification – any one of the below – Oracle Certified Master – Java EE 6 Enterprise Architect Oracle Certified Professional – Java EE 7 Application Developer (1Z0-900) Oracle Certified Professional – Java SE 7 Programmer Oracle Certified Professional – Java SE 8 Programmer
Job Segment: Application Developer, ERP, Developer, Java, Software Engineer, Technology,